Citadel had its open beta this weekend just days before its early access coming up on the 26th of July. The best way to begin our impressions feature is with three words: wizards, wands, and dragons. This sandbox takes what is best in games like Ark and DayZ and brings it into a solid fantasy genre where you are a wizard. Instead of guns and dinosaurs, you’ll have spells, staves, and plenty of monsters to battle and tame.

    I posted this on the DnL article, but I also played Citadel and thought there was a lot of potential there. Citadel definitely felt much more Early Access than DnL though. NPC movement was really awful for me as well. You can easily troll people and take their kingdoms/bases by destroying the one floor that the throne is on, which auto destroys the throne and then place your own and boom, it's yours! (brought me back to the days of Reign of Kings a bit). Melee is pointless currently. The wand is OK, but sucks in PvP. The staff is the only good choice for weapon path currently. Their building system is really bad, flying is pretty sweet and there is a lot of mana management. Overall, I liked it and felt it was different enough from DnL. I likely will get it after a few patches.

    The devs behind Citadel have put a lot of effort into customizing the game and not using the same bundled assets that Ark and DnL have used. So while there are some similar mechanics Citadel is ahead due to the effort the devs have put into it including a customized UI instead of the bundled one with UE4. DnL is ark with a bigger world and magic, it still uses all the same assets as Ark.

    Citadel had to add almost 100 overflow servers for the open access period. Both Citadle and DnL suffered from pretty bad lag which is always expected of any game on release. DnL takes 5 to 10 minutes to get in game just from loading, similar to Ark, citadel gets you into game faster, a lot faster.
